  • Patent number: 11046350
    Abstract: An installation device is used to install a steering wheel onto a steering column having a plurality of column splines, wherein the steering wheel includes a plate with a central opening and a plurality of wheel splines configured to engage the plurality of column splines. The installation device includes a frame including a base and a cover removably coupled to the base. The installation device also includes a first magnification lens coupled to the frame, and a first pair of posts coupled to the base. The first pair of posts are configured for insertion into a pair of corresponding openings on the steering wheel such that the first pair of posts position the first magnification lens a first predetermined distance from the steering wheel to focus the first magnification lens on the plurality of wheel splines.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: February 12, 2020
    Date of Patent: June 29, 2021
    Assignee: HONDA MOTOR CO., LTD.
    Inventors: Michael J. Maure, Benjamin B. MacArthur, Thien Phung, Matthew Gowthorpe, Tyler John Edward Thomas Zettler, Matthew Peter Gleeson
  • Patent number: 5706559
    Abstract: A vehicular leaf spring plate tip liner insert is provided, having a variety of configurations (50, 100, 150, 200, 250), of which one preferred embodiment is referenced by numeral (50). Insert (50) has a pad portion (3) adapted to provide a pad between adjacent leaf spring tips and at least one shank portion (4) extending from pad portion (3). Shank portion (4) is axially divided into two pairs of opposed protuberances (14, 14' and 16, 16'), with each pair having surfaces in registration with each other that are at different axial distances from pad portion (3) and engageable with the side of leaf spring opening opposite to the side into which shank portion (4) is inserted and are able to secure insert (50) to a leaf spring plate having a range of thicknesses upon expanding away from each other upon passing through the leaf spring tip opening.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: October 18, 1996
    Date of Patent: January 13, 1998
    Assignee: Eaton Corporation
    Inventors: James J. Oliver, Richard F. Pierman, Michael J. Maure
